A home inspector, however, looks much more closely at the home and its systems—including electrical, plumbing, and appliances—to find problems. A home inspector’s job is to find any potential issues that the buyer should know about before moving forward with the purchase. If a home inspection reveals bad news—like a leaky roof, asbestos or mold, or an air conditioner on its last limb—the buyer can walk away from the deal or lower their offer.

A residential home’s appraisal fees range from $300 to $425 depending on the type of loan and the home’s location and condition. But rural areas may have high costs, too, if the appraisal lacks comparable properties or other unusual circumstances. A home appraisal is a formal process by which an independent, licensed appraiser assesses a home to determine its fair market value.

If you’re buying a new home and the appraisal comes in low, your mortgage lender won’t lend you more than the appraised amount. You can opt to pay cash to cover the difference between the appraised value and the loan amount, or you can negotiate for a lower sale price or decide not to move forward with the purchase. If you’re refinancing your home or using a mortgage to finance the purchase of a new home, your lender will likely require you to get an appraisal before you can close on the loan.

A home appraisal costs $350 to $600 on average, depending on the property size, location, appraiser experience, and loan type. Appraisals for FHA and VA home loans cost $400 to $900 due to their specific requirements. A house appraisal is used to estimate the property’s real estate market value. Even though most lenders require an appraisal as a condition of closing on a house, the buyer pays for the appraisal unless they negotiate for the seller to pay instead.

Homeowners who are refinancing need to make sure the appraised value hasn’t slipped since they bought the home. Their current mortgage is based on that previous value, so a decrease could possibly make the bid for a new mortgage more complicated or not possible.

If you feel you received a low appraisal and want to challenge the conclusions in the report, you can contact the lender. It’s best to send the information in writing, and it’s possible a revised appraisal could be ordered. The report is usually sent to the buyer when the lender gets it, at least three days before the closing date.
